Hallo leute, ich weis nicht, ob ich in das richtige forum schreibe, ansonsten verlegt den artikel bitte in das richtige forum.
wir haben im Büro einen Asterisk Server und der läuft soweit auch rund!
ich habe aber das problem, dass Problem ist, dass wenn kunden anrufen und diese in der Warteschlange landen den ansage text "ANSAGE1" nicht hören! ich benötige diesen jedoch, vor der warteschleife, um die Kunden darauf aufmerksam zu machen wo sie sind, und dass sie zum nächsten freien mitarbeiter gelangen.
wenn ich allerdings hingehe, und die ansage direkt in die inbound root hänge, kommt die ansage, nur habe ich da (zumindest bei FreePBX) nicht die möglichkeit, anschließend in die warteschlange zu gelangen.
meine frage ist nun, wie ist es möglich, eine ansage machen zu lassen bevor die eigentliche warteschlange kommt?
das System ist eine Trixbox 2.0 mit einer quad bri karte von junghanns und den standardtreibern für diese trixbox version
den relevanten teil der extensions-aditional.conf liegt kommt im anschluss.
vielen Dank für eure Antworten schon im Vorraus
haggi
[ext-queues]
include => ext-queues-custom
exten => 400,1,Answer
exten => 400,n,Set(__BLKVM_OVERRIDE=BLKVM/${EXTEN}/${CHANNEL})
exten => 400,n,Set(__BLKVM_BASE=${EXTEN})
exten => 400,n,Set(DB(${BLKVM_OVERRIDE})=TRUE)
exten => 400,n,Set(_DIAL_OPTIONS=${DIAL_OPTIONS}M(auto-blkvm))
exten => 400,n,Set(__NODEST=${EXTEN})
exten => 400,n,GotoIf($["${CONTEXT}"="from-internal"]?USERCID:SETCID)
exten => 400,n(USERCID),Macro(user-callerid,)
exten => 400,n(SETCID),Set(CALLERID(name)=${CALLERIDNAME})
exten => 400,n,Set(MONITOR_FILENAME=/var/spool/asterisk/monitor/q${EXTEN}-${TIME
exten => 400,n,Queue(400|t||custom/ANSAGE1|150)
exten => 400,n,dbDel(${BLKVM_OVERRIDE})
exten => 400,n,Set(__NODEST=)
exten => 400,n,Goto(ext-local,${VM_PREFIX}4888842,1)
exten => 400*,1,Macro(agent-add,400,)
exten => 400**,1,Macro(agent-del,400,400)
wir haben im Büro einen Asterisk Server und der läuft soweit auch rund!
ich habe aber das problem, dass Problem ist, dass wenn kunden anrufen und diese in der Warteschlange landen den ansage text "ANSAGE1" nicht hören! ich benötige diesen jedoch, vor der warteschleife, um die Kunden darauf aufmerksam zu machen wo sie sind, und dass sie zum nächsten freien mitarbeiter gelangen.
wenn ich allerdings hingehe, und die ansage direkt in die inbound root hänge, kommt die ansage, nur habe ich da (zumindest bei FreePBX) nicht die möglichkeit, anschließend in die warteschlange zu gelangen.
meine frage ist nun, wie ist es möglich, eine ansage machen zu lassen bevor die eigentliche warteschlange kommt?
das System ist eine Trixbox 2.0 mit einer quad bri karte von junghanns und den standardtreibern für diese trixbox version
den relevanten teil der extensions-aditional.conf liegt kommt im anschluss.
vielen Dank für eure Antworten schon im Vorraus
haggi
[ext-queues]
include => ext-queues-custom
exten => 400,1,Answer
exten => 400,n,Set(__BLKVM_OVERRIDE=BLKVM/${EXTEN}/${CHANNEL})
exten => 400,n,Set(__BLKVM_BASE=${EXTEN})
exten => 400,n,Set(DB(${BLKVM_OVERRIDE})=TRUE)
exten => 400,n,Set(_DIAL_OPTIONS=${DIAL_OPTIONS}M(auto-blkvm))
exten => 400,n,Set(__NODEST=${EXTEN})
exten => 400,n,GotoIf($["${CONTEXT}"="from-internal"]?USERCID:SETCID)
exten => 400,n(USERCID),Macro(user-callerid,)
exten => 400,n(SETCID),Set(CALLERID(name)=${CALLERIDNAME})
exten => 400,n,Set(MONITOR_FILENAME=/var/spool/asterisk/monitor/q${EXTEN}-${TIME
exten => 400,n,Queue(400|t||custom/ANSAGE1|150)
exten => 400,n,dbDel(${BLKVM_OVERRIDE})
exten => 400,n,Set(__NODEST=)
exten => 400,n,Goto(ext-local,${VM_PREFIX}4888842,1)
exten => 400*,1,Macro(agent-add,400,)
exten => 400**,1,Macro(agent-del,400,400)